Composition needed to make Green Veg with a Creamy Avocado & Charred Chilli Dressing:

  1. Avo Dressing
  2. 1/2 very ripe avocado
  3. Olive oil
  4. 1 red chilli
  5. Salad
  6. Handful frozen peas
  7. 4-5 stems of tender stem broccoli
  8. Salt and pepper

Instructions to cook Green Veg with a Creamy Avocado & Charred Chilli Dressing:

  1. Scorch the chilli whole over a gas job or by roasting in the oven on a high heat for 5-10 mins until it’s blackened. Scrape the skin off with a knife and then chop the chilli.
  2. Add the avocado and chilli to a blender. Add a tbsp of olive oil and blend, then add more oil slowly until a thick dressing consistency is reached. Add a pinch of salt and pepper to taste.
  3. Cook the peas in boiling water for 3 mins then add the chopped broccolini for a further 2 minutes. Drain then put in your serving bowl. Drizzle with the dressing, season again with salt and pepper if you want to and top with some finely chopped fresh chilli.
